Tips for Baking Perfect Cookie Dough Brownies

To ensure your Cookie Dough Brownies turn out absolutely perfect every time, here are a few simple tips:

  • Don’t Overmix the Brownie Batter: Overmixing can lead to dry, tough brownies. Mix just until the flour streaks disappear for that perfectly fudgy and chewy texture.
  • Cool Brownies Completely: It’s crucial that your brownies are fully cooled before you spread the cookie dough on top. If the brownies are warm, the cookie dough will melt and make a mess. Patience is key here!
  • Flour Treatment for Cookie Dough (Optional but Recommended): Since this is an eggless cookie dough meant to be eaten raw, it’s a good practice to heat treat your flour. You can do this by spreading the flour on a baking sheet and baking it at 350°F (175°C) for about 5-7 minutes, or until it reaches 160°F (71°C) with an instant-read thermometer. Let it cool completely before using. This step ensures any potential bacteria in the raw flour are eliminated, making your cookie dough even safer to enjoy.
  • Even Cookie Dough Layer: For a beautiful presentation and balanced taste, try to spread the cookie dough evenly over the cooled brownies. A small offset spatula or the back of a spoon works wonders.
  • Chill for Easy Slicing: After layering, refrigerate the brownies for at least an hour (or longer) until the cookie dough layer is firm. This makes for much cleaner cuts and neat squares.
  • Storage: Store your Cookie Dough Brownies in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to a week. They are fantastic cold, but you can also let them come to room temperature for a softer bite.

Ingredients

For the Brownies
  • ½ cup (1 stick) unsalted butter, melted
  • ¾ cup white sugar
  • ¾ cup light br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2 eggs
  • ¾ cup all-purpose flour
  • ½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• ½ teaspoon salt
For the Cookie Dough
  • ¼ cup (½ stick) butter, softened
  • ¼ cup brown sugar
  • ¼ cup white s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 3 tablespoons milk of choice
  • 1 cup (4¼ oz.) all-purpose flour
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 cup mini chocolate chips

Instructions

For the Brownies
  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line an 8×8-inch pan with parchment paper or foil, leaving an overhang on two sides for easy removal. Lightly grease.
  2. In a large bowl, combine the melted butter, white sugar, brown sugar, and vanilla extract. Whisk well until smooth and fully incorporated. Beat in the eggs, one at a time, mixing thoroughly after each addition until the mixture is well blended and glossy.
  3. In a separate med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, unsweetened cocoa powder, and salt. Gradually add the dry flour mixture into the wet egg mixture, stirring gently with a wooden spoon or spatula until just blended. Be careful not to overmix. Spread the batter evenly into the prepared baking dish.
  4. Bake in the preheated oven for approximately 30 minutes, or until an inserted toothpick into the center comes out with moist crumbs attached, but not wet batter. Avoid overbaking. Remove the pan from the oven and let it cool completely on a wire rack before proceeding to add the cookie dough layer.
For the Cookie Dough Layer
  1. In a medium bowl, cream together the softened butter, brown sugar, and white sugar until the mixture is light and fluffy. Whisk in the vanilla extract and milk of your choice until smooth. Gradually mix in the all-purpose flour and salt until well blended and a cohesive dough forms. Finally, gently stir in the mini chocolate chips until they are evenly distributed throughout the dough.
  2. Once the brownies are completely cooled, evenly spread the prepared cookie dough in a thick layer on top of them. For best results, press the dough down gently and smooth the top with a spatula or the back of a spoon. Refrigerate the pan for at least 1 hour, or until the cookie dough layer is firm enough to easily cut into neat squares. Enjoy!
